Dr Izzard act to follow

TRANSVESTITE comic Eddie Izzard will play the new Dr Who when the show returns to TV screens, according to former Time Lord Tom Baker.

Beeb bosses have been keeping the name of the new Doctor under wraps for months.

But this morning actor Tom - who played the role between 1974 and 1981 - spilled the beans in an interview on Radio 5 live.

Asked what the comic would bring to the role, he said: "He has an alien quality.

"Eddie Izzard is so mysterious and strange. He seems like he has lots of secrets. You always feel Eddie Izzard knows something you don't, or has been somewhere you haven't been.

And he added: "I like the way he dresses. He could probably do his own wardrobe."

But an official BBC spokesperson brushed off the claim, saying Baker's comments were purely speculation.

Bookies favourites to land the role remain Jonathan Creek star Alan Davies and Richard E Grant.

The popular sci-fi series will return with a new script penned by Queer As Folk creator Russell T Davies in 2005.
